[ If we assume the picture represents the load end of a cable, and the telescoping shield (1) is not attached at the other end of the cable (floating), do you attach a 0.01 uF capacitor between the telescopic shield and the RCA barrel at the load end? Is this correct? ]

Not quite. You would place the 0.01 uf DISC CERAMIC cap as you stated, but the source end of the extra shield would be connected to ground.

What this type of connection does, is provide a "floating shield" within the operating band of the cable, yet terminates the shield at higher RF frequencies.
